Output de07c7296588ae9e3699a58b52ee69315c57d84094deae579f0620f6c1b7ea5d:0

value
11883800
script pubkey
OP_0 OP_PUSHBYTES_20 b9f7854a6dd9111e36ba7a6efc30159cb2c30388
address
bc1qh8mc2jndmyg3ud460fh0cvq4njevxquggulpy9
transaction
de07c7296588ae9e3699a58b52ee69315c57d84094deae579f0620f6c1b7ea5d
confirmations
271837
spent
true